Film distribution is a difficult industry—cinemas are limited, film festivals are flooded with submissions, and viewers are overwhelmed by choices. In this interview Irit Neidhardt, one of the few Arab film distributors, provides insight into the different complications the film industry and filmmakers are now facing from both a global and Middle East perspective.

Irit Neidhardt is associate producer of the award-winning feature-documentary Recycle (2007), and co-producer of the highly acclaimed The One Man Village (2008) and prizewinning Fidia (2012). From 2014–2016 she was an Honorary Fellow at the European Centre for Palestine Studies at the University of Exeter, UK. She is a member of the German Documentary Association and has served in juries for several film festivals and funding institutions in Germany, Egypt, Jordan, Palestine, and Lebanon.
